41-year-old Reagan Gurney died in the hospital following a bicycle crash; hit-and-run motorist sought (New Orleans, LA)

41-year-old Reagan Gurney died in a hospital following a hit-and-run accident that took place on October 8 in the Seventh Ward.

As per the initial information, the fatal bicycle crash occurred on Fri., Oct. 8 at about 9:15 p.m. at the intersection of Law and Bruzelles Streets, close to Broad Street and St. Bernard Avenue. The investigation reports showed that Gurney was in the hospital on life support since the accident.

Authorities were able to identify the suspect vehicle as a silver, possibly a Nissan Altima or Maxima. Investigators are seeking public’s help in identifying and finding the vehicle and the driver. Detectives stated that the vehicle should have heavy front-end damage.

The incident remains under active review.
